as the title says, what's the easiest way to draw a circle on a picture? just the boarder with the inside transparent?
![]() I always end up doing it in a retarded way by overlaying two circles but its hard getting the second one overlapped well

Use the ellipse tool to draw your circle.
..then from the menu select Layer\Layer style\stroke. That lets you assign an outer line properties, then change the ellipse fill to 0% ...lots of other style options available in there too.

Ugh I finally figured what was wrong, I tried both instructions but it just wouldn't work, until I saw that "Color overlay" in the layer style menu was set to difference instead of Normal which is why the circled kept on getting filled. Thanks for the help guys, it's made my life easier
